Land of Genesis

by adminpublished on July 23, 2023

A nature documentary shot entirely in Israel, Land of Genesis follows three mammals in their respective geographic habitats, as the seasons change.The wolves of the Golan Heights, the swamp cats of the Sea Of Galilee and the ibexes of the desert are shown in the most beautiful way.

Rising Sun Media Presents: Don't Forget Me

Tom's doctor at the Eating Disorder Clinic where she is committed says that she's getting better. The thought of getting healthy and heavy scares her. It looks like it is going to be the worst day of her life. And then Tom meets Neil, a socially awkward tuba player. Together they try to escape from their lives and all that is considered socially acceptable.

Don't Forget Me is a dark yet heartwarming indie comedy about the need to be out of your mind in order to fall madly in love. Presented in Hebrew language, with optional English subtitles. WINNER, BEST FILM, Tarkovsky International Film Festival 2017, Russia WINNER, BEST FILM, BEST ACTOR, BEST ACTRESS, Torino International Film Festival 2017, Italy WINNER, CNC AWARD, Jerusalem Film Festival 2017
Rising Sun Media Presents: Asura Girl

Asura Girl

A live-action movie based on the popular animation series "Blood C" by Production I.G and CLAMP. Set in Japan before World War II, a captain of the fascist Special Political Police (the "SPP") was murdered in a small village. During a brutal investigation conducted by the SPP, tensions between the SPP and villagers grow, and soon the conflict leads to violence – and the sudden appearance of the mysterious, sword-wielding “Asura Girl”!

Directed by: OKU SHUTARO Starring: KAEDE AONO, RYUNOSUKE MATSUMURA, ARATA FURUTA, KANON MIYAHARA Japanese Language, with optional English subtitles. 2022, Japan.
Rising Sun Media Presents: Acre Dreams

Acre Dreams

Azam Salameh, a Palestinian theater director, directs an autobiographical play in the mixed Jewish-Arab city of Acre. The play takes place in 1947, during the final days of the British Mandate, and tells a love story between his grandmother, the singer Layla and Dr. Alfasi, the last Jewish citizen who remained in the city of Acre during the War of 1948. The play comes under threat and never sees the stage. This film is the only remaining testimony.
